Youll be instrumental in shaping a proactive, data-driven purchasing function that enables the business to thrive.KEY RESPONSIBILITIESManage and lead the purchasing function across all BVC Group venues.
Develop and maintain strong relationships with suppliers, negotiating favourable terms and ensuring service excellence.
Oversee procurement of all food, beverage, equipment, and non-food items, ensuring best quality and value.
Monitor and manage stock levels across sites to ensure availability while reducing waste and overstocking.
Implement purchasing systems and controls to track orders, budgets, and supplier performance.
Conduct regular pricing reviews and identify opportunities for cost savings and efficiency.
Collaborate with chefs, GMs, and finance to forecast demand, plan orders, and align on menu or operational changes.
Maintain up-to-date records of purchasing activity, contracts, and compliance documentation.
Ensure all procurement practices meet health and safety, sustainability, and ethical sourcing standards.
Support new venue openings with procurement planning and supplier setup.
